Court orders are not required only in case of student loans. For defaults on credit card debts, the CA must file papers in the court and summons should be served to you in hand. You need to file complaints with your state attorney general about this company because they have illegal garnished on your wages. Inform your payroll and don't let them do a debit again.

Did you answer the presumed summons? If not, I think it is possible the attorney has obtained a default judgement against you. I'd check with the courthouse...maybe even obtain copies of all the documents in your case.
